Somerset maugham 25 january 1874 16 december 1965 william somerset maugham was born at the british embassy in paris, france, where his father was an english lawyer handling the legal affairs of the british embassy. Both maughams parents died before he was 10, and the orphaned boy was raised by a paternal uncle who was emotionally cold.
